hiugat
Tagalog
Etymology
From hi- (removal prefix) + ugat (“root”).
Coined by Lupon sa Agham (Committee on Science) in the Maugnaying Talasalitaang Pang-agham : Ingles-Pilipino (Correlative Word List for Sciences : English-Filipino), published in 1969 and edited by Gonsalo del Rosario. This term fell under the Kublupon sa Sipnayan (Subcommittee on Mathematics), headed by Manuel M. Maravilla.
Pronunciation
- (Standard Tagalog) IPA(key): /hiʔuˈɡat/ [hɪ.ʔʊˈɣat̪̚]
- Rhymes: -at
- Syllabification: hi‧u‧gat
Noun
hiugát (Baybayin spelling ᜑᜒᜂᜄᜆ᜔) (mathematics, neologism)
- evolution (extraction of roots)
